What is Equity Lifestyle Properties's casualty-related charges/(recoveries), net?
Equity Lifestyle Properties (ELS) reported casualty-related charges/(recoveries), net of $68K in Q1 2026.
How has Equity Lifestyle Properties's casualty-related charges/(recoveries), net changed year-over-year?
Equity Lifestyle Properties's casualty-related charges/(recoveries), net decreased by 68.7% year-over-year, from $217K to $68K.
What does casualty-related charges/(recoveries), net mean?
The net cost or gain resulting from property damage and insurance settlements.
How do you interpret casualty-related charges/(recoveries), net?
Higher costs indicate significant property damage or inadequate insurance coverage, while recoveries suggest successful mitigation or insurance payouts.
How does casualty-related charges/(recoveries), net compare across companies?
Highly dependent on geographic exposure; peers in similar climate zones will show comparable volatility patterns.
